Perfect for a child who has outgrown the crib, this toddler bed features a sleigh design and 2 side rails that will keep your child from falling out. It's low to the ground, making it easier for your child to climb right into bed. Made from solid wood. From Delta.

We love this bed! It is a great product and a great value. We were torn whether to get a regular twin bed or this in -between. Our daughter was 3 and was still sleeping fine in her crib but had been climbing out of it for at least 6 months. We just held off as long as we could. We actually had a twin bed frame in our attic which we planned to use. $300.00 later with a mattress & box springs, (hadn't even purchased sheet set yet) the bed was at least 3 feet off the ground and it swallowed her up when she laid on it. It was just too big. So we decided to try the toddler bed for $85.00 total with site to store delivery and it is fabulous. It uses her crib mattress and sheets so no big change. She loves it. It is made of solid wood and is low to the ground. The quality is excellent. She still has plenty of room to grow in it as well. For $85.00 I'll be happy if I get another 9mos - 1 year out of it... It is perfect for us!

The bed came in a box too small for it (not long enough), but labeled correctly. Inside, the side bar was comprised of two pieces, not one, and instructions were for another bed: one with side bar comprised of two pieces of wood (on each side) with an additional leg in the middle of each side for additional support. No additional legs were in the box though, and without them, the bed could not take any weight. Obviously, there is no additional leg on either side of the picture you see (just a total of 4, not 6 legs). Therefore, there must have been a huge mishmash of packaging, labeling, pieces for assembly and instructions at the manufacturer/packaging sight. Be wary.

The bed went together fine. I wasn't expecting the side rails to be in two parts. The picture shows a solid board for the side rails, but they acutally come in two pieces you put together with a little leg in the middle. Had I known that, I would have chosen another bed. However, it works just fine for my son. It's just not as cut as the picture because of the little legs in the middle of the side rails.
